Tesla have opened up a select number of sites for non-Tesla charging and wondered if anyone has used one yet? Charging rates etc. I ask as a regular charging stop-off of mine on the A14 has both Ionity and Tesla chargers, the Ionity is poor charging rate, no better than a conventional 50kWh charger at McDonalds most of the time so hoping Tesla is better.

Curious to know what charging rate you are getting at the Ionity station - bear in mind the car won't charge at the full 125kWh rate immediately, and will start to slow down once the battery is close to full, i.e. there's a curve.
